Air Force Chapel In Colorado Springs. The nearly 60-year-old multi-faith chapel will undergo renovations throughout the next four years. This aluminum glass and steel structure features 17 spires that shoot 150 feet into the sky. With 46m high is placed on an area adjacent to the Court of. The Air Force Academy Chapel was built in 1956 - 1962 by architect Walter Netsch with Skidmore Owings and Merrill.
